The current lifetime ban on MSM donors was created in the 1980s, when very little was known about AIDs. The condition was initially named Gay-Related Immunodeficiency Disease (GRID) and was thought to only affect homosexual men, often called ;The Gay Plague' or 'The Gay Disease'. Surely we are not still so ignorant?
